How many counties in Indiana State?

There are 92 counties in Indiana State,details are as follows:

Allen County
Adams County
Benton County
Brown County
Boone County
Bartholomew County
Blackford County
Clinton County
Carroll County
Clark County
Cass County
Clay County
Crawford County
Delaware County
DeKalb County
Decatur County
Dubois County
Daviess County
Dearborn County
Elkhart County
Franklin County
Fulton County
Fayette County
Floyd County
Fountain County
Greene County
Grant County
Gibson County
Harrison County
Henry County
Hancock County
Howard County
Hamilton County
Huntington County
Hendricks County
Jefferson County
Jasper County
Jackson County
Johnson County
Jennings County
Jay County
Knox County
Kosciusko County
Lake County
Lawrence County
LaGrange County
LaPorte County
Madison County
Marion County
Monroe County
Morgan County
Miami County
Martin County
Montgomery County
Marshall County
Noble County
Newton County
Ohio County
Orange County
Owen County
Putnam County
Pulaski County
Pike County
Perry County
Porter County
Posey County
Parke County
Randolph County
Rush County
Ripley County
St. Joseph County
Sullivan County
Steuben County
Shelby County
Scott County
Spencer County
Switzerland County
Starke County
Tippecanoe County
Tipton County
Union County
Vermillion County
Vanderburgh County
Vigo County
Wayne County
Washington County
Wabash County
Warren County
White County
Warrick County
Whitley County
Wells County
